Comparison Of Different Methods To Determine Amino Acid Digestibility Of Feed For Yellow-feathered Broilers

This study was conducted to compare the concentration of titanium dioxide(Ti O2)and amino acid in excreta of cecectomized rooster or ileal digesta of canulated or slaughtered rooster and amino acid digestibility.Then,the amino acid digestibility of corn and soybean meal as well as their additivity were compared between the values determined with excreta of cecectomized rooster or ileal digesta of slaughtered rooster.The results will provide a proper reference to determine digestibility of amino acid.In experiment 1,186 yellow-feathered roosters were cecectomized and 47yellow-feathered roosters were surgically fitted with a T-cannula at the distal ileum.The recovery after operation was evaluated for cecectomy and ileal cannulation.A single factor completely random deign was adopted to estimate the effect of sources of digested samples on the amino acid digestibility.A total of 3 sources of digested samples were excreta of cecectomized roosters,ileal digesta of cannulated roosters or slaughtered roosters.The results showed that the BW gain of cecectomized roosters was not significantly different with that of cannulated rooster at 7,14,21 days after surgery(P>0.05).The death and cull rates of the first and second batch of cecectomized roosters and cannulated roosters were23.1%,20.4%,33.9%,respectively.There was a significant difference in concentration of Ti O2,several amino acids and their digestibility in determination with excreta of cecectomized roosters,ileal digesta of cannulated roosters or slaughtered roosters(P<0.05).Overall,the concentration of Ti O2and amino acid,digestibility of amino acid and their coefficient of variation determined with excreta of cecectomized roosters were close with ileal digesta of slaughtered roosters.But greater coefficient of variation in concentration of Ti O2and amino acid,digestibility of amino acid was observed on determination with ileal digesta of cannulated roosters.Experiment 2 was conducted to compare the differences between slaughter and cecectomy method to determine amino acid digestibility of corn and soybean meal and their additivity in a corn-soybean meal diet,which will provide a reference for the accurate determination of amino acid digestibility in chicken feed.A two-sample experiment was adapted to compare slaughter and cecectomy method to determine endogenous amino acid excretion and amino acid digestibility of corn,soybean meal and a corn-soybean meal.Each treatment contained 6 replicates with 3 chickens per replicate.The calculated amino acid digestibility of the corn-soybean meal diet was arithmetically expected according to the digestibility and proportion of individual ingredients in the mixed diet.The additivity of amino acid digestibility between corn and soybean meal was tested by comparing the calculated and determined values of amino acid digestibility in mixed diet.The results showed that the values of slaughter method were 2.2 times in endogenous excretion of 16amino acids and 8.2 times in mean value of SE of cecectomy method.Except for His and Gly,the endogenous excretions of 14 amino acids in slaughter method were significantly higher than those of cecectomy method(P<0.05).Apparent digestibility of some amino acids in corn(Met and Phe),soybean meal and corn soybean meal(15 amino acids except Gly)determined with slaughter method was significantly lower than these with cecectomy method(P<0.05).Mean SE of apparent digestibility of amino acids in slaughter method was 2.6 to 3.5 times of that in cecectomy method.Slaughter method had close standardized amino acid digestibility in maize(except Gly)to that in cecectomy method.Whereas,the standardized digestibility of some amino acid in soybean meal(13 amino acids except Lys,Cys and Gly)and corn soybean meal diet(Arg,Ile,Leu,Val,Asp,Glu,Pro)was lower in slaughter method than cecectomy method(P<0.05).The mean SE of standardized digestibility of amino acids in slaughter method was 2.4 to 3.1 times of that in cecectomy method.The calculated values were significantly different from the determined values of apparent digestibility of most amino acids(except Ala and Cys)and standardized digestibility of Lys in corn-soybean meal diets using slaughter method(P<0.05).The calculated values were significantly different from the determined values of apparent digestibility(Leu,Lys,Met,Thr,Val,Ala,Asp)and standardized digestibility(Ile,Leu,Met,Phe,Val,Ala,Asp,Ser)of some amino acids in corn-soybean meal diets using cecectomy method(P<0.05).In conclusion,slaughter method has higher the endogenous amino acid excretion but lower apparent and standardized digestibility of some amino acids than cecectomy method.The additivity of apparent amino acid digestibility in slaughter method was lower than cecectomy method.The additivity of standardized amino acid digestibility in slaughter method was better than cecectomy method,which may relate to the greater variation among replicates of slaughter method.
